In 2025, the iconic Dubai Marathon is getting even bigger thanks to an exciting new partnership with Guinness World Records! This is YOUR chance to set a world record while running in one of the most thrilling sporting events in the region on January 12, 2025!

The Guinness World Records team have shared a host of fun and unusual record categories for you to try. Want to run while dribbling a basketball or football? Or perhaps you’re up for the challenge of running the marathon blindfolded? Fancy donning a school uniform or a suit? Or how about running with an egg and spoon or even hula hooping while you race?

There’s something for everyone—and you could be the one to set a brand-new world record!

This collaboration isn’t just about breaking records; it’s about inspiring communities to embrace sports and challenge themselves in new ways. Shaddy Gaad, Senior Marketing Manager at Guinness World Records, emphasised how this initiative aligns with their mission to encourage people to push the boundaries of what’s possible. “This partnership with the Dubai Marathon offers participants an incredible opportunity to enter the record books while celebrating sports and healthy living,” he said.

Registration for record attempts at the Dubai Marathon will be completely free of charge from Guinness World Records. Additionally, participants will enjoy expedited processing and immediate consideration for record approval.

Imagine crossing that finish line, not just as a marathon finisher—but as a world record holder!

The deadline to apply for a record during the Dubai Marathon 2025 is: 1 January 2025.
